Kentucky's New Cash Crop?

March 2, 1998

-- Mike Fenwick of member station WUKY reports that a brewing company in Kentucky has found another use for hemp, incorporating it in its brewing process to create a new light tasting beer. They say it's a natural substitute or addition to its botanical cousin... hops. It's part of an effort by Kentucky businesses and farmers to find innovative uses for industrial hemp as an alternative cash crop to tobacco which has an uncertain future.
